Our August meeting brought us three nominations:

  • Naomi's House - a residential program designed to offer hope, healing and a new beginning to women who have suffered commercial sexual exploitation.

    http://www.moodychurch.org/naomis-house/

  • Family Bridges - helping families learn skills to improve their family life and financial situations

    https://familybridgesusa.com

  • Loaves and Fishes - a food pantry that helps families who are food insecure and provides assistance in other ways to help families move toward financial security.

    https://www.loaves-fishes.org

Lisa Barry nominated Naomi’s House and it received the most votes. The house in DuPage County where we presented our checks on Friday, September 21st to a most thankful Executive Director, Simone Halpin. We learned about her program and how it helps women get the help and courage to take back their lives.
